Epilogue

epilogue
 also epilog  noun  Etymology: Middle English epiloge, from Middle French ~, from Latin epilogus, from Greek epilogos, from epilegein to say in addition, from epi- + legein to say — more at legend  Date: 15th century  1. a concluding section that rounds out the design of a literary work  2.  a. a speech often in verse addressed to the audience by an actor at the end of a play; also the actor speaking such an ~  b. the final scene of a play that comments on or summarizes the main action  3. the concluding section of a musical composition ; coda
